Job Details Job Location: Hybrid Work Arrangement - Grand Rapids, MN 55744 Position Type: Full Time Salary Range: $32.75 - $33.75 Hourly About Us Blandin Foundation, located in Grand Rapids, Minn., is a private philanthropic organization focused on championing rural communities across Minnesota. Through grantmaking, advocacy, and community-building, we work to strengthen and elevate rural voices, address critical issues, and cultivate vibrant, thriving communities in our region. The Accounting Associate is an integral part of the Finance team, ensuring accurate and timely financial operations that support the Foundation’s ability to steward resources effectively and advance our mission of moving rural places forward. The Finance team plays a key role in stewarding the Foundation’s resources by ensuring financial data is accurate, timely, and aligned with strong internal controls. As part of this team, the Accounting Associate provides essential day-to-day accounting and administrative support. By managing payroll support, accounts payable, and other transactional processes, this position helps maintain the accuracy and efficiency of financial operations that make it possible for the Foundation to advance its mission. Position Summary The Accounting Associate provides day-to-day accounting and administrative support for the Foundation’s financial operations. This role processes payroll and accounts payable and performs general accounting functions. Key Responsibilities Payroll Process payroll through the Foundation’s third-party payroll system; ensure timecards are entered and approved, collaborate with HR to ensure any payroll changes are updated, and process appropriate journal entries. Prepare and submit HSA and retirement contribution reports, ensuring accurate and timely upload to the respective vendor portals. Assist with payroll-related audit and tax schedules,5500 annual census, and provide information for surveys and workers’ compensation audits. Review payroll forms (including Form 941, W-2) for accuracy. Develop and maintain proficiency in the payroll system, utilizing it effectively to support efficiency and continuous quality improvement, while proactively bringing forward ideas for process enhancements. 2. Accounts Payable Process accounts payable in accordance with organizational procedures. Enter invoices into the Financial Management System, ensuring accurate coding, and timely processing. Track and obtain vendor documentation (e.g., W-9s), ensuring compliance with 1099 reporting requirements. Prepare Forms 1099 and 1096 for review. Develop and maintain proficiency in the financial management system, utilizing it effectively to support efficiency and continuous quality improvement, while proactively bringing forward ideas for process enhancements. Ensure finance-related contracts are drafted and signed in accordance with Finance policies and procedures 3. Accounting and Audit Support Assist with month-end, quarter-end, and year-end processes. Draft audit and tax schedules related to payroll and accounts payable for timely review. Assist with other audit and tax preparation, as requested. Provide support for miscellaneous finance projects. 4. General Administrative Support Maintain accurate documentation of procedures and processes for assigned responsibilities, assisting with other finance documentation as needed. Provide additional administrative and accounting support as needed.
